Pressure sores or ulcers ( commonly
known as Bed Sores or decubitus ulcers)
continue to challenge the health professional.
Pressure ulcers occur too frequently when
one considers that they can usually be avoided.
Pressure relieving devices can protect the
skin from the effects of pressure, friction
and moisture. Medical sheepskins are
one of the best and cost effective devices
available for the prevention of pressure
sores. They provide excellent protection
when placed under the back, calves and heels.

The dense 30mm wool pile of HiTemp Urine
Resistant Medical Sheepskins provides
an interface between the patient and the bed
that reduces pressure, friction and moisture-
the primary causes of pressure sores.

Using HiTemp UR
Medical Sheepskins ( AS
4480.1) for maximum benefits:
1. Place the sheepskin directly on the sheet,
drawsheet or seat with the wool facing up.
2. Place the patient so that there is direct
contact between the wool and the skin.
3. Prolonged use will compact the wool pile.
For maximum benefit, the sheepskin should
be removed and shaken to restore the pile.
Launder in woolskin as needed. This will restore
the pile and disinfect the wool. Comb with
a coarse toothed plastic hair brush to revitalise
the pile.
